Liquidnet hires Trading executive at Morgan Stanley

Executive Director at Morgan Stanley and 11-year veteran Alex Grinfeld has joined a notable group of senior analysts and futures sales-traders who have joined Liquidnet since 2022 as the tech-focused agency execution specialist, well-known for its dark pools, expands its offering of listed derivatives globally.

Grinfeld held the position of Vice President for Futures and Derivatives Sales Trading at Goldman Sachs before moving to Morgan Stanley.

Alongside Brian Cashin, who joined Liquidnet in March 2022 after being hired from Bank of America, he will co-lead the company's rapidly expanding futures division in the Americas.

This is in response to the company's recent introduction of products like pre- and point-of-trade analytics, which assist automation and help traders make more informed decisions. In the past, banks have mostly supplied the purchase side with executions and solutions.

 

"Alex joins us at an exciting time in our journey; his extensive experience will be invaluable as we launch new technology and further develop our execution services," stated Mike du Plessis, Global Head of Listed Derivatives.

Similar moves were made in Europe, where the firm poached Darren Smith and Dan Noorian from UBS 18 months ago to head the Liquidnet Listed Derivatives team in London, which had just recently been formed. These senior additions in the US are a reflection of those actions. The two have a strong futures legacy, much like their Liquidnet Americas colleagues, having worked for the Swiss bank for about 15 years apiece.
